Default Advice needed ECU/wiring harness after engine swap

I'm looking to swap out my D17a1 engine from my 2004 Honda Civic LX for a D17a2 engine from an EX. I need to change the ECU and get a wiring harness that matches it. Can I get any ECU that matches the engine's description or do I need to get a certain part number? Also, what kind of wiring harness should I be looking for?

Default Re: D17A1 Engine for D17A2

Not an expert but I axed a similar question and I was told that you need the harness and ecu from a vtec car. I believe the harness has 1 extra wire for vtec solenoid. You'll have to reprogram the new ecu to accept the your current keys.

ebay. local junk yards. car-part.com is a searchable inventory of junk yards around the country. find the part and call em up.

I believe the harness/ecu can come off any vtec car from 2001-2005.

I forgot to add, I was also told that you can install a vtec engine in a non-vtec car with no issues even if you stay with the same non-vtec harness/ecu. The only difference is the vtec won't work. So it'll run exactly like a d17a1.

Default Re: D17A1 Engine for D17A2

prodjay is correct
Im not no expert either, but my mechanic did this for me. JDM d17a into my LX
And its been 1 year and still running fine. He said don't need new ecu or harness just leave the vtec unplugged.
Runs better than d17a1 originally in my LX, but no vtec will kick in

no CEL, no problems, same good mpg

ps. save your money and go my route, but if you want the vtec, I assume yes you would need the vtec ecu and harness for a EX d17a2 (01-05), and reprogram keys
